The most important thing to remember when cooking on a fire pit is that you need the right type of flames and fire. You may think that because you're cooking over a fire, you need it to be roaring, but you'd be wrong. Similar to a BBQ the best fire for cooking should be made up of mainly glowing coals. 2. Use the right firewood. The fuel for your fire pit is very important for getting the best cooking results. FirepitsUK advises using dry wood, with a moisture content of less than 20%. It's much harder to get a decent, hot fire burning with damp wood, plus it will create lots of smoke.

Another great way to cook nearly anything on a fire pit is with a simple metal grate placed over the fire. This can be done by using the edge of your fire pit, or placing bricks or blocks to hold the grate. For ours, we used the same metal post concept (using 4 posts) to place the grate over the fire.

Modify your fire pit for cooking, our preferred option is a metal grate large enough for several Field Skillets. 2. Stick to hardwoods, like oak, hickory and maple—they burn hotter for longer and have more mellow smoke flavors. 3. Light your fire 60 to 90 minutes before beginning to cook—you want your wood to be burning down into coal.
